An emotional memoir from Hall of Fame, Super Bowl winning former head coach of the Pittsburgh Steelers and current CBS analyst, Bill Cowher. Born and raised just fifteen minutes from old Three Rivers Stadium, it was in Crafton where the foundation of Cowher's work ethic, passion for teaching, and love of football and the Pittsburgh Steelers were built. Here Cowher takes readers on his journey from childhood to the undersized North Carolina State linebacker, to fighting for a spot with the Browns and Eagles, before injuries ended his playing career. He shares never-before-told anecdotes and candid thoughts on the biggest games, players, and moments that defined his fifteen-year Steelers tenure. -- adapted from jacket
